The Science Behind Afrin’s Effectiveness

Afrin is a popular nasal spray used to relieve congestion caused by colds, allergies, and sinus infections. Its key ingredient is oxymetazoline, a potent vasoconstrictor. This means it narrows the blood vessels in your nasal passages. When these vessels swell during congestion, your nose feels blocked and stuffy. By tightening those blood vessels, Afrin reduces swelling and opens up the airways almost immediately.

Oxymetazoline works directly on alpha-adrenergic receptors in the smooth muscle lining of blood vessels. When activated, these receptors cause the muscles to contract, shrinking the vessels’ diameter. This contraction reduces blood flow to the swollen tissues inside your nose, leading to less inflammation and mucus buildup.

Because of this targeted effect, Afrin provides relief within minutes after spraying. The relief usually lasts for 10 to 12 hours, which is why many people use it once or twice daily during severe congestion episodes.

How Afrin Differs from Other Nasal Decongestants

Not all nasal sprays act the same way as Afrin. Some contain saline solutions that simply moisturize nasal tissues without constricting blood vessels. Others use steroids or antihistamines that reduce inflammation by different mechanisms but take longer to work.

Afrin’s rapid vasoconstriction makes it stand out because:

    • Immediate relief: You can breathe easier within minutes.
    • Long-lasting effect: A single dose can keep your nose clear for up to half a day.
    • Targeted action: It acts locally in the nose without significant systemic effects when used properly.

However, this power comes with caution. Using Afrin for more than three consecutive days can cause rebound congestion—a worsening of symptoms caused by overuse. This happens because prolonged vasoconstriction leads to tissue damage and dependence on the spray.

The Role of Oxymetazoline in Afrin’s Success

Oxymetazoline is a synthetic sympathomimetic amine that mimics the effects of adrenaline on blood vessels. It selectively binds to alpha-1 and alpha-2 adrenergic receptors in nasal mucosa. This selective binding causes smooth muscle contraction without widespread stimulation of other receptors that might cause unwanted side effects.

This selectivity explains why Afrin effectively reduces nasal swelling without causing significant increases in heart rate or blood pressure when used as directed.

The chemical structure of oxymetazoline allows it to remain active on receptors for several hours before being metabolized or cleared away. This prolonged receptor engagement accounts for the extended duration of nasal relief.

How Quickly Does Afrin Work?

Afrin is known for its fast onset of action—usually within 5 minutes after application. The spray delivers oxymetazoline directly onto the swollen nasal mucosa, allowing immediate receptor activation.

Once sprayed:

    • The drug binds to alpha-adrenergic receptors.
    • Smooth muscles around blood vessels contract.
    • Blood flow decreases, reducing swelling.
    • Nasal passages open up.
    • You experience easier breathing.

This process happens quickly compared to oral decongestants or steroid sprays that require systemic absorption or gradual anti-inflammatory effects.

Afrin’s Safety Profile and Usage Guidelines

While Afrin works wonders for quick relief, it must be used responsibly:

    • Limit use: No more than 3 days consecutively to avoid rebound congestion (rhinitis medicamentosa).
    • Dosage: Typically 2 sprays per nostril every 10-12 hours as needed.
    • Avoid overuse: Excessive application can damage nasal tissues permanently.
    • Caution with certain conditions: People with high blood pressure or heart disease should consult doctors before using.

Rebound congestion occurs when prolonged vasoconstriction causes reduced oxygen supply and irritation in nasal tissues. Once you stop using Afrin after extended periods, swollen tissues worsen dramatically. This vicious cycle traps users into continuous use.

Doctors often recommend combining Afrin with saline sprays or steroid nasal sprays during longer treatment courses to minimize rebound risks.

The Impact of Overuse: Rhinitis Medicamentosa

Rhinitis medicamentosa is a condition marked by persistent nasal congestion caused by overusing topical decongestants like Afrin. The mechanism involves:

    • Diminished receptor sensitivity due to constant stimulation.
    • Damage and inflammation of nasal lining from lack of oxygenated blood flow.
    • A vicious cycle where swelling worsens as medication wears off.

Symptoms include chronic stuffiness even without cold symptoms and dependence on sprays for normal breathing.

Treatment involves stopping Afrin use gradually under medical supervision while managing symptoms with alternative therapies such as corticosteroid sprays or saline rinses.

Afrin Compared: Oxymetazoline vs Other Decongestants

Many over-the-counter decongestants exist besides oxymetazoline-based sprays like Afrin:

Decongestant Type Main Ingredient(s) Onset & Duration
Afrin (Oxymetazoline) Oxymetazoline hydrochloride (0.05%) Onset: ~5 mins
Duration: 10-12 hrs
Naphazoline Sprays Naphazoline hydrochloride Onset: ~5-10 mins
Duration: 4-6 hrs
Xylometazoline Sprays (Otrivin) Xylometazoline hydrochloride (0.1%) Onset: ~5-10 mins
Duration: 8-10 hrs
Pseudoephedrine (Oral) Pseudoephedrine hydrochloride Onset: 15-30 mins
Duration: 4-6 hrs
Steroid Nasal Sprays (Fluticasone) Corticosteroids (e.g., Fluticasone propionate) Onset: Hours to days
Duration: Long-term control only

Among these options, oxymetazoline’s combination of rapid onset and long duration makes it ideal for quick symptom relief during acute congestion episodes.

The Role of Dosage Formulation in Effectiveness

Afrin’s formulation as a fine mist spray ensures even distribution across nasal mucosa for maximum receptor contact. The concentration (0.05%) balances potency with safety—high enough for effective vasoconstriction but low enough to reduce systemic absorption risks.

The spray bottle design allows precise dosing and prevents excess medication use compared to drops or gels that may be harder to control.

The Physiology Behind Nasal Congestion Relief With Afrin

Nasal congestion results mainly from inflammation-induced dilation and increased permeability of tiny blood vessels called capillaries within the mucous membranes lining your nose. Allergens, viruses, or irritants trigger this inflammatory response causing:

    • Tissue swelling due to fluid leakage from capillaries into surrounding tissue.
    • Mucus gland hypersecretion increasing thick mucus production.

Both factors narrow airways making breathing difficult.

Afrin interrupts this process by constricting arterioles supplying these capillaries so less fluid leaks out into tissue spaces resulting in decreased swelling and mucus formation.

This physiological action explains why Afrin not only improves airflow but also reduces runny noses temporarily by limiting mucus production indirectly through reduced inflammation stimulus.

The Nervous System Connection: Adrenergic Receptors Explained

Adrenergic receptors are nerve-linked proteins responding primarily to adrenaline-like chemicals controlling vascular tone throughout the body including your nose.

Oxymetazoline targets two subtypes:

    • Alpha-1 receptors: Located mostly on vascular smooth muscle causing contraction when stimulated.
    • Alpha-2 receptors: Located pre-synaptically; their activation inhibits further release of norepinephrine reducing excessive sympathetic activity.

By activating both receptors locally in your nose, oxymetazoline produces balanced vasoconstriction without triggering widespread nervous system effects such as increased heart rate—making it safe if used correctly at recommended doses.
